The National Health Institute coordinates, throughout the country, the Public Health Laboratory Network (LSP), responsible for specialized diagnostics, laboratory surveillance, investigation, and response to public health outbreaks and emergencies.

Public Health Laboratories play a strategic role in strengthening the national health system, ensuring specialized laboratory analyses in the areas of Microbiology, Parasitology, Virology, Cellular Immunology, Entomology, Molecular Diagnostics, and Genetic Sequencing, among others. PHLs also ensure the implementation of Quality Management Systems, External Quality Assessment, and training and technical supervision activities for the national laboratory network.

The Public Health Laboratories Network is comprised of:

  1. Maputo Province Public Health Laboratory (Headquarters)
  2. Inhambane Provincial Public Health Laboratory
  3. Sofala Provincial Public Health Laboratory
  4. Manica Province Public Health Laboratory
  5. Tete Provincial Public Health Laboratory
  6. Zambézia Province Public Health Laboratory
  7. Nampula Provincial Public Health Laboratory
  8. Niassa Province Public Health Laboratory
  9. Cabo Delgado Provincial Public Health Laboratory
